GeminiSpellChecker (Проверка орфографии, расстановка знаков препинания, перевод при помощи API AI)
- Автор: 'By Zloy Ltd
- Исходный код дополнения: Посетить Web-сайт geminiSpellChecker
Краткое описание
Gemini Spell Checker - это мощное дополнение для NVDA, использующее искусственный интеллект для проверки орфографии, грамматики и перевода текста.
Поддерживает два сервиса: Google Gemini и Groq API.
Проверяет и исправляет ошибки в тексте, переводит на более чем 40 языков.
Работает с выделенным текстом и буфером обмена.
Автоматически переключается между моделями при ошибках.
Включает опцию добавления смайликов в исправленный текст.
Простой в использовании: выделите текст и нажмите горячие клавиши для проверки или перевода.
Требует API ключи от выбранного сервиса.
Сочетания клавиш можно изменить в жестах ввода, в категории «Spell Checker».
Функциональность дополнения подробно описана в справочном руководстве.
Основная информация
| Название | Версия | Совместимость с API NVDA | Последняя протестированная версия NVDA | Минимальная версия NVDA | Дата загрузки в каталог | Размер | Лицензия |
|---|---|---|---|---|---|---|---|
| geminiSpellChecker | 1.3 | 2025.1 | 2025.3 | 2023.3 | 28-10-2025 17:22:16 | 23 Кб. | GPL v2 |
Информация о локализации на русский язык
- Локализация от: Разработчик или другой переводчик
- Перевод: Да
- Перевод интерфейса: Да
- Перевод справки: Да
Скачать
GeminiSpellChecker-V.1.3.nvda-addon
⬇ Перейти к истории версий 🔝 Назад к оглавлениюРазделы
🔝 Назад к оглавлениюСправка
Подробнее
Gemini Spell Checker для NVDA
Мощный плагин для проверки орфографии и перевода текста с использованием AI
📋 Оглавление
- Общее описание
- Установка и настройка
- Получение API ключей
- Жесты ввода
- Использование
- Настройки плагина
- Устранение неполадок
- Поддерживаемые языки
📋 Общее описание
Плагин Gemini Spell Checker для NVDA предоставляет мощные возможности проверки орфографии и перевода текста с использованием современных AI-моделей от Google Gemini и Groq.
Основные возможности:
✅ Проверка орфографии - Автоматическое исправление орфографических и грамматических ошибок в выделенном тексте
🌐 Перевод текста - Перевод на 50+ языков с сохранением форматирования и смысла
🔄 Два сервиса - Поддержка Google Gemini и Groq API с возможностью переключения
😊 Смайлики - Опциональное добавление релевантных эмодзи в результат
📋 Автокопирование - Результат автоматически копируется в буфер обмена
⚙️ Установка и настройка
Требования:
- NVDA 2023.1 или новее
- Активное интернет-соединение
- API ключ от одного из сервисов
Настройка плагина:
- Откройте меню
NVDA → Настройки → Gemini Spell Checker - Выберите сервис (Google Gemini или Groq API)
- Введите соответствующий API ключ
- Настройте жесты ввода через меню
NVDA → Настройки → Жесты ввода
💡 Совет: Начните с бесплатного сервиса Groq, так как он предоставляет более щедрые лимиты для начала работы.
🔑 Получение API ключей
Google Gemini API
- Перейдите на Google AI Studio
- Войдите в свой Google аккаунт
- Нажмите "Create API Key"
- Скопируйте сгенерированный ключ
- Вставьте ключ в настройках плагина
Бесплатно: Gemini API бесплатен для ограниченного количества запросов.
Groq API
- Перейдите на Groq Console
- Зарегистрируйте аккаунт или войдите
- Нажмите "Create API Key"
- Дайте ключу название и скопируйте его
- Вставьте ключ в настройках плагина
Бесплатно: Groq предоставляет бесплатные запросы с лимитами.
⚠️ Важно: Никому не передавайте свои API ключи. Храните их в безопасности!
⌨️ Жесты ввода
Настройте жесты в меню NVDA → Настройки → Жесты ввода в категории "Gemini Spell Checker":
| Действие | Описание | Рекомендуемый жест |
|---|---|---|
| Проверка орфографии | Проверка правописания выделенного текста | NVDA+G |
| Перевод текста | Перевод выделенного текста на выбранный язык | NVDA+T |
| Следующий язык | Переключение на следующий язык перевода | NVDA+СтрелкаВправо |
| Предыдущий язык | Переключение на предыдущий язык перевода | NVDA+СтрелкаВлево |
| Проверка подключения | Тестирование соединения с API | NVDA+Alt+G |
| Переключение сервиса | Смена между Gemini и Groq | NVDA+Shift+G |
| Показать настройки | Отображение текущей конфигурации | NVDA+Alt+S |
💡 Совет: Назначайте жесты, которые не конфликтуют с другими плагинами и стандартными командами NVDA.
🚀 Использование
Проверка орфографии:
- Выделите текст в любом приложении
- Нажмите назначенный жест для проверки орфографии
- Дождитесь обработки (2-10 секунд)
- Исправленный текст будет скопирован в буфер обмена
- NVDA озвучит превью результата
Перевод текста:
- Выделите текст для перевода
- Нажмите жест для перевода
- Выберите нужный язык через жесты переключения
- Переведенный текст будет скопирован в буфер обмена
Переключение языков:
Используйте жесты "Следующий язык перевода" и "Предыдущий язык перевода" для циклического перебора всех доступных языков.
⚠️ Ограничение: Максимальная длина текста - 5000 символов. Работает только с выделенным текстом.
⚙️ Настройки плагина
Основные настройки:
- Сервис для проверки - Выбор между Google Gemini и Groq API
- API ключи - Ввод соответствующих ключей доступа
- Модель - Выбор конкретной AI-модели
- Добавлять смайлики - Включение/выключение добавления эмодзи
- Язык перевода - Выбор целевого языка для переводов
Доступные модели:
Gemini модели:
gemini-2.0-flash-expgemini-2.0-flashgemini-2.5-flash-expgemini-2.5-flash
Groq модели:
llama-3.1-8b-instantllama-3.1-70b-versatilellama-3.2-1b-previewllama-3.2-3b-previewllama-3.3-70b-versatilemixtral-8x7b-32768gemma2-9b-it
💡 Рекомендация: Для начала используйте
gemini-2.0-flash-expилиllama-3.1-8b-instant- они быстрые и надежные.
🔧 Устранение неполадок
Частые проблемы и решения:
❌ "Неверный API ключ"
- Проверьте правильность введенного ключа
- Убедитесь, что ключ активен
- Проверьте лимиты использования API
Решение: Перегенерируйте ключ в консоли разработчика и обновите в настройках
❌ "Таймаут подключения"
- Проверьте интернет-соединение
- Попробуйте позже
- Проверьте настройки firewall
Решение: Перезагрузите роутер, проверьте подключение к api.groq.com или generativelanguage.googleapis.com
❌ "Превышен лимит запросов"
- Слишком много запросов
- Исчерпана дневная квота
Решение: Дождитесь обновления квоты или переключитесь на другой сервис
❌ "Модель не найдена"
- Модель временно недоступна
- Неправильное название модели
Решение: Выберите другую модель в настройках или используйте резервную
Логирование:
Для детальной диагностики включите ведение логов NVDA и проверьте журнал (NVDA+F1) после возникновения ошибки.
💡 Профилактика: Регулярно обновляйте плагин для получения исправлений и новых функций.
🌍 Поддерживаемые языки
Плагин поддерживает перевод на 50 языков:
- English - Английский
- Russian - Русский
- Spanish - Испанский
- French - Французский
- German - Немецкий
- Italian - Итальянский
- Portuguese - Португальский
- Chinese - Китайский
- Japanese - Японский
- Korean - Корейский
- Arabic - Арабский
- Turkish - Турецкий
- Hindi - Хинди
- Bengali - Бенгальский
- Urdu - Урду
- Indonesian - Индонезийский
- Dutch - Нидерландский
- Polish - Польский
- Ukrainian - Украинский
- Greek - Греческий
- Hebrew - Иврит
- Thai - Тайский
- Vietnamese - Вьетнамский
- Persian - Персидский
- Malay - Малайский
- Romanian - Румынский
- Hungarian - Венгерский
- Czech - Чешский
- Swedish - Шведский
- Danish - Датский
- Finnish - Финский
- Norwegian - Норвежский
- Bulgarian - Болгарский
- Croatian - Хорватский
- Serbian - Сербский
- Slovak - Словацкий
- Slovenian - Словенский
- Lithuanian - Литовский
- Latvian - Латышский
- Estonian - Эстонский
- Maltese - Мальтийский
- Icelandic - Исландский
- Irish - Ирландский
- Welsh - Валлийский
- Basque - Баскский
- Catalan - Каталанский
- Galician - Галисийский
⚠️ Ограничения:
- Максимальная длина текста: 5000 символов
- Только выделенный текст: Не работает с текстом из буфера обмена
- Требуется активное интернет-соединение
💡 Примечание: Плагин использует внешние API сервисы. Ознакомьтесь с политикой конфиденциальности соответствующих сервисов.
Поддержка: Для вопросов и предложений обращайтесь к разработчику плагина.